Google + is the latest upgrade from Google. It used to be called Google Places, but Google changed the format to allow for more interaction between “circles” and friends. It’s kind of a cross between Facebook, FourSquare and Linkedin. You can add photos and videos; custom categories like your service area, brands you sell and how to find parking; and coupons to encourage customers to make a first-time or repeat purchase.
Google+ now hosts 250 million accounts and 150 million monthly active users, the company said Wednesday. Facebook boasts more than 900 million monthly active users.
Some of the benefits of the new Google + is:
- Unlike Facebook, you don’t have to be a member to join,
- Hangouts – Hangouts let you catch up with friends and family, whether you’re at home on your computer or using the Google+ mobile app on the go. Up to 10 people can join a hangout, and it’s easy to invite specific friends or circles,
- Free – It’s like having your own little website on Google. More people search for businesses online than anywhere else, so it’s important to make sure your local business listing can be easily found on Google.com and Google Maps,
- Google + is showing up on organic Google Searches
- Your clients can add reviews
- Edit your listing and speak for yourself. Your business probably already shows up on Google, but you should still verify your listing and make sure its details are accurate and thorough.
